Recommendations (8)

Implement DNSSEC

Activate DNSSEC with your domain registrar and add the DS records to your parent zone. This protects against DNS spoofing attacks.

Impact: Significantly increases security and prevents DNS manipulation

Add MX records

Configure MX records pointing to your mail servers so you can receive email.

Impact: Enables your domain to receive email

Configure DMARC

Add a DMARC record to _dmarc.yourdomain.com, for example: "v=DMARC1; p=quarantine; rua=mailto:[email protected]"

Impact: Protects against phishing and provides insight into email abuse

Implement DKIM

Configure DKIM signing with your email provider and publish the DKIM public key in DNS.

Impact: Improves email deliverability and prevents spoofing

Add IPv6 support

Request AAAA records from your hosting provider for your website. IPv6 is becoming increasingly important.

Impact: Makes your website accessible to IPv6-only networks

Add CAA records

Define which Certificate Authorities may issue SSL certificates, for example: "0 issue letsencrypt.org"

Impact: Prevents unauthorized certificate issuance

IPv6 for mail servers

Add AAAA records for your MX servers to support email via IPv6.

Impact: Improves email reachability for IPv6 networks

Enable HTTP/3 (QUIC)

Enable HTTP/3 for faster page loads and improved connection resilience. Nginx: add "listen 443 quic reuseport;" and "add_header Alt-Svc 'h3=":443"; ma=86400'". Caddy: HTTP/3 is enabled by default. Cloudflare: Enable under Speed → Protocol Optimization. Also add an HTTPS DNS record: example.com IN HTTPS 1 . alpn="h3,h2" Ensure UDP port 443 is open in your firewall (QUIC uses UDP, not TCP).

Impact: Faster page loads (0-RTT), better mobile performance, and connection migration between networks
